    About this Product

    Smart cards require careful shipping and handling to maintain integrity. Use static-dissipative packaging, dry storage, and avoid direct sunlight. Ensure proper cushioning and limit stacking to 3 layers.

    Product Specifications

    • Material: Plastic or PVC
    • Size Options: Standard 85x54mm
    • Load Capacity: 50 lbs per pallet
    • Coating: Anti-static
    • Applications: ID verification, access control
    • NMFC Code: 152310 (suggested)
    • Freight Class: Class 125 (suggested)

    Note: All specifications listed are suggested values.

    Shipping Methods & Advantages

    LTL freight

    Best for 1–3 units or smaller batches that do not require a full truck.

    FTL freight

    Ideal for 5+ units or bulk shipments headed to large retail warehouses.

    Air freight

    Fastest option for urgent deliveries or time-sensitive placements.

    Reefer freight

    Recommended when the shipment includes temperature-sensitive contents.

    Handling Requirements

    Avoid direct sunlight, vibrations, and moisture. Use protective sleeves and pallet covers. Ensure 10ft door access for forklifts.

    Packaging Specs

    Static-dissipative packaging is critical to prevent electrostatic discharge. Individual sleeves and foam inserts recommended.
